On Thu, May 01, 2014 at 06:00:41PM +0100, Neil Roberts wrote:
> If the scale for the cursor surface doesn't match that of the output
> then we shouldn't use the cursor overlay because otherwise it will be
> drawn at the wrong size. This problem is particularly noticable with
> multiple pointers because it randomly alternates between drawing one
> cursor or the other at a larger size depending on which one gets put
> in the cursor overlay.

> ---
>  src/compositor-drm.c | 3 +++
>  1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/src/compositor-drm.c b/src/compositor-drm.c
> index 9d293bc..4441308 100644
> --- a/src/compositor-drm.c
> +++ b/src/compositor-drm.c
> @@ -953,12 +953,15 @@ drm_output_prepare_cursor_view(struct weston_output 
> *output_base,
>  {
>       struct drm_compositor *c =
>               (struct drm_compositor *) output_base->compositor;
> +     struct weston_buffer_viewport *viewport = &ev->surface->buffer_viewport;
>       struct drm_output *output = (struct drm_output *) output_base;
>  
>       if (c->gbm == NULL)
>               return NULL;
>       if (output->base.transform != WL_OUTPUT_TRANSFORM_NORMAL)
>               return NULL;
> +     if (viewport->buffer.scale != output_base->current_scale)
> +             return NULL;
>       if (output->cursor_view)
>               return NULL;
>       if (ev->output_mask != (1u << output_base->id))
